นี่คือที่เก็บสำหรับ SelectStarsQl.com มันเป็นหนังสือแบบโต้ตอบที่สอน SQL โดยการถ่ายทอดแบบจำลองทางจิตสำหรับการเขียนแบบสอบถาม
โครงสร้างของรหัสเป็นมาตรฐานที่ค่อนข้างดีสำหรับไซต์ที่สร้างโดย Jekyll ดูโครงสร้างไดเรกทอรี Jekyll
หน้าทั้งหมดจะถูกเก็บไว้เป็นไฟล์ Markdown (.MD) ในไดเรกทอรีระดับบนสุด Jekyll ใช้ไฟล์ markdown เหล่านี้และแปลงเป็นไฟล์ HTML ใน /_site ในระหว่างการแปลงมันทำสิ่งที่ประหยัดพลังงานเย็น ๆ ทุกประเภทเช่นการฝังไว้ในเทมเพลตที่มีส่วนหัวและองค์ประกอบส่วนท้ายที่เป็นมาตรฐาน เทมเพลตเหล่านี้จะถูกเก็บไว้ใน /_layouts
คุณสามารถให้บริการเวอร์ชันท้องถิ่นได้โดยใช้ jekyll serve
ความซับซ้อนทางเทคนิคหลักอยู่ในแบบฝึกหัด SQL แบบโต้ตอบ สิ่งเหล่านี้ถูกนำมาใช้เป็นแท็ก HTML ที่กำหนดเองใน /scripts/main.js Firefox ไม่รองรับองค์ประกอบ HTML ที่กำหนดเองตามค่าเริ่มต้นดังนั้นเราจึงดึงไลบรารี custom-elements.min.js จาก UNPKG (ดู _layouts/default.html .)
หากต้องการมีส่วนร่วมส่งอีเมลถึงฉันโดยตรงที่ [email protected] หรือส่งคำขอดึงโดยทำตามขั้นตอนเหล่านี้:
bundle install )git clone https://github.com/MYUSERNAME/selectstarsql/jekyll serve และตรวจสอบการเปลี่ยนแปลงของคุณบนเบราว์เซอร์ของคุณตามที่อยู่ localhost ของคุณ นี่อาจจะเป็น http://127.0.0.1ร้อยแก้วของหนังสือเล่มนี้ได้รับใบอนุญาตจาก Zi Chong Kao ภายใต้ใบอนุญาต Creative Commons By-SA 4.0 ซึ่งอนุญาตให้แบ่งปันและปรับตัวภายใต้ใบอนุญาตเดียวกันและมีการระบุแหล่งที่มา รหัสและชุดข้อมูลจะถูกปล่อยออกสู่โดเมนสาธารณะภายใต้ใบอนุญาต Creative Commons CC0